The utilization of dark mode, or "dark theme," has gained increasing popularity in recent years. This display mode has even become the default choice for most smartwatches. However, it is noteworthy that screens were initially black. The first personal computers with integrated screens, launched in 1977, featured entirely black backgrounds. At that time, the screens were equipped with cathode-ray tubes, and the phosphorescent layer was green, resulting in green text on a black background.
Over time and with technological advancements, light mode screens began to dominate the market. Experts generally agree that light mode is more ergonomic and comfortable for users. This transition to light mode was influenced by several factors, including the anatomy of the human eye. Indeed, our pupils adjust based on the amount of available light, which can make reading on a dark screen more challenging.
Studies have even been conducted to measure the impact of dark mode on reading. An experiment carried out in 2013 showed that performance was significantly better with light mode. White letters on a black background can create a luminous halo around the text, making reading blurrier and less pleasant.
Dark mode has experienced a resurgence in popularity in recent years, particularly due to major technology companies like Google and Apple incorporating it into their operating systems. But why this renewed interest in a feature that existed in the early days of computing?
Several reasons account for this. First, dark mode has become a popular aesthetic choice, often associated with a certain idea of luxury or modernity. Applications like Discord and Spotify have also contributed to its popularization by using it as the default display mode. Moreover, there exists a common belief that dark mode is easier on the eyes, although studies have shown that this is not necessarily the case.
However, dark mode does offer some undeniable advantages. It emits less blue light, which can be beneficial for sleep quality, as blue light can disrupt the production of melatonin, the sleep hormone. Additionally, dark mode is more energy-efficient, especially with OLED screens where each pixel is individually lit. Although the energy savings are not as significant as some might think, they can be meaningful on a larger scale.
Regarding readability, light mode appears to have an advantage, particularly when characters are small. Studies have shown that reading is faster and more accurate in light mode. However, the choice between light mode and dark mode can also be a matter of personal preference. Some developers and traders prefer dark mode because it better highlights colors, which is useful for charts and coding.
Ultimately, the use of light or dark mode may depend on the context. Light mode is generally preferable during the day for better readability, while dark mode may be more appropriate in the evening to minimize exposure to blue light. Modern devices often allow for automatic switching between the two based on the time of day.
For those with specific medical conditions like cataracts or photophobia, continuous use of dark mode may help reduce light exposure and alleviate symptoms. In the end, the choice between light mode and dark mode depends on various factors, including your specific needs and personal preferences.
